Why Springtime Sleep Is Harder Than You Assume



Most individuals expect to rest much better as soon as winter season ends. The reality is more challenging. Longmont rests at approximately 5,000 feet in altitude, and the Front Variety springtime is infamously unforeseeable. One week brings 70-degree afternoons; the next declines snow on flowering tulips. These quick temperature level swings make it tough for your body to resolve right into a steady rest rhythm.



Add to that the dramatic boost in daylight. Longmont obtains virtually 2 hours of additional daylight between early March and late Might. While that additional sunlight feels terrific, it reduces melatonin production previously in the evening, which indicates numerous homeowners find themselves large awake at 10 PM when they used to relax normally by 8:30.



Understanding these neighborhood forces at work is the first step toward constructing a rest regimen that actually stands up via spring.



Set Your Room Temperature Prior To the Period Shifts



One of the most efficient and underrated rest techniques is regulating your room environment. The optimal rest temperature for the majority of grownups drops in between 65 and 68 levels Fahrenheit. During Longmont's spring, bedroom temperatures can swing drastically from evening to night, and your body has to compensate.



Start propping home windows open throughout the cool night hours to allow fresh mountain air flow normally. If your ceiling fan has actually been resting still all winter months, get it running once more. Lighter bed linen likewise makes a significant difference-- transitioning from a hefty wintertime comforter to a lighter quilt or covering layers you can readjust can reduce those uneasy, overheated nights that become usual by mid-April.

Protect Your Light Direct Exposure Throughout the Day



The relationship in between light and sleep is direct and powerful. Your body clock-- the body clock regulating sleep and wakefulness-- is tuned virtually completely by light signals. In springtime, taking care of that input deliberately makes a huge distinction in exactly how well you rest.



Get outside early. A 15-minute walk in the early morning sunshine, whether along the St. Vrain Greenway or merely around your community, supports your body clock and informs it that the day has actually begun. That morning signal after that anticipates when you will begin generating melatonin at night.



As the evening methods, lower the lights inside your home. Avoid bright above illumination after 8 PM, and consider switching to warmer-toned bulbs in the spaces where you spend your nights. Address Allergies Before They Swipe Your Sleep



Longmont's springtime air carries actual plant pollen tons from turfs, trees, and blooming plants throughout the region. For the substantial part of locals that take care of seasonal allergies, this is just one of the most significant rest disruptors the season brings.



Nasal congestion, itchy eyes, and post-nasal drip can fragment rest throughout the night also when you do not totally wake up. The result is fatigue that feels confusing since you practically stayed in bed for eight hours.



Practical actions consist of showering before bed to eliminate plant pollen from your hair and skin, maintaining windows closed throughout high-pollen mid-day hours, and using a high quality air filter in your room. Readjust Your Arrange Gradually, Not Simultaneously



One of one of the most typical springtime sleep blunders is making unexpected schedule adjustments. You start keeping up later on because there is still daylight at 8 PM, or you awaken earlier due to the fact that the sun is coming through your drapes at 5:30 AM. In time, these drifts gather into a rest deficiency that blunts your efficiency and state of mind throughout the day.



The smarter approach is incremental. If your timetable is shifting, move your going to bed and wake time by 15 mins every few days instead of leaping an hour at once. Use power outage drapes or a good sleep mask to separate your waking hint from the sunup if necessary. Longmont's spring early mornings are beautiful, but you get to select when that appeal wakes you up.



Uniformity throughout weekdays and weekend breaks matters greater than lots of people admit. Oversleeping 2 hours on Saturday due to the fact that you stayed up late Friday essentially gives yourself moderate jet lag entering into the work week. Keep your wake time as consistent as feasible, and trust that your body will normally readjust its rest timing as the season supports.



Stay Consistent With Workout, yet Time It Intelligently



Exercise is among the greatest natural rest aids offered, best site and spring in Longmont virtually invites you outdoors. The tracks at Button Rock Preserve, the courses along Union Reservoir, and the quiet roads of older communities all make for excellent activity chances.



Early morning and mid-day exercise sustains better nighttime rest. Energetic activity within a couple of hours of bedtime, nonetheless, increases cortisol and core body temperature level in ways that press sleep beginning later. Save your extreme workouts for earlier in the day, and make use of the evening hours for lower-effort activity that helps you unwind rather than rev up.
